Tennessee SB 1956 (114) — State Government - As enacted, prohibits a state agency from issuing or renewing a certification, registration, license, or permit to a corporate entity if an officer, director, or employee of the entity provides material support or resources, meeting spaces, or other forums to certain terrorist groups or organizations for the purpose of soliciting material support or recruiting new members; requires a state agency to deny, revoke, or refuse or renew a certification, registration, license, or permit issued to such entities upon receipt of satisfactory proof of such activity. - Amends TCA Title 4; Title 8; Title 48 and Title 67.

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2026-01-22 Filed for introduction filing
  • 2026-02-02 Introduced, Passed on First Consideration introduction
  • 2026-02-05 Passed on Second Consideration, refer to Senate State and Local Government Committee referral-committee
  • 2026-02-24 Placed on Senate State and Local Government Committee calendar for 3/3/2026
  • 2026-03-03 Recommended for passage with amendment/s, refer to Senate Calendar Committee Ayes 6, Nays 0 PNV 2
  • 2026-03-10 Placed on Senate Regular Calendar for 3/12/2026
  • 2026-03-12 Sponsor(s) Added. sponsorship
  • 2026-03-12 Engrossed; ready for transmission to House receipt
  • 2026-03-12 Passed Senate as amended, Ayes 27, Nays 5 passage
  • 2026-03-12 Senate adopted Amendment (Amendment 1 - SA0553)
  • 2026-03-16 Rcvd. from S., held on H. desk.
  • 2026-04-06 Passed H., as am., Ayes 86, Nays 10, PNV 0 passage
  • 2026-04-06 H. adopted am. (Amendment 1 - HA0918) amendment-passage
  • 2026-04-06 Subst. for comp. HB. substitution
  • 2026-04-07 Placed on Senate Message Calendar for 4/9/2026
  • 2026-04-09 Enrolled and ready for signatures enrolled
  • 2026-04-09 Concurred, Ayes 24, Nays 4 (Amendment 1 - HA0918) passage
  • 2026-04-14 Signed by Senate Speaker passage
  • 2026-04-16 Signed by H. Speaker passage
  • 2026-04-17 Transmitted to Governor for action. executive-receipt
  • 2026-04-27 Signed by Governor. executive-signature
  • 2026-05-05 Effective date(s) 04/27/2026
  • 2026-05-05 Pub. Ch. 843
